Sage Capital Global

Sage Capital Global is a London-headquartered private equity firm running a multi-strategy mandate that spans early-stage venture, growth equity, buyouts, PIPE transactions, and venture debt. The firm does not publicly anchor its identity to a single founding figurehead or a disclosed wealth source, instead presenting as a deployment platform capable of accessing deals from seed to control. This breadth of mandate positions the firm to compete across categories — writing early-stage checks, providing structured growth capital, and participating in public-market private placements — all under one roof. The strategy is built around flexibility, combining direct venture and growth exposure with buyout control and credit instruments. The venture debt capability is a structural note: most generalist private equity managers do not run a venture-debt sleeve alongside buyout and growth equity, which suggests Sage either fills a niche in providing non-dilutive capital to founders or supplements its equity returns with credit-oriented yield. The firm's London location naturally pulls toward European deal flow, but a PIPE capability typically requires a dual US-Europe lens, indicating probable transatlantic activity. Without named portfolio companies or disclosed fund sizes, the specific sector weights remain private, though the strategy tags imply the firm is mandate-driven rather than thesis-narrow. The structural differentiator is the rare layering of venture debt onto a private equity platform that also does early-stage seed and PIPE deals. Most firms with this mix are either large multi-strategy asset managers (like BlackRock or Apollo) or specialized growth-credit platforms (like Hercules Capital). A smaller London-based firm combining all five strategies is architecturally unusual, suggesting either a deliberate strategy of serving underserved companies across the full financing lifecycle or a loosely federated set of teams operating under a shared brand. Frequently asked questions

What investment strategies does Sage Capital Global operate?

According to the firm's own materials, Sage Capital Global deploys across five distinct strategies: early-stage venture (seed), growth equity, buyouts, PIPE transactions (private investment in public equity), and venture debt. This range is unusually broad for a smaller, London-based manager and suggests the firm is organized around financing-vehicle flexibility rather than a single sector or stage thesis.
